WELLE-D A Wireless Traffic Transport for Wired Networks
Abstract
WIRELESS DEVICES ARE MORE PREVALENT NOWTHAN EVER BEFORE. New Wi-Fi-enabled smart devices are being introduced at a rapid pace now that security and infrastructure monitoring systems are becoming commonplace. Everything from monitor cameras to HVAC and lighting systems are now being modernized to include data monitoring and control, and its common today for new, off-the-shelf systems to contain built-in wireless capabilities. With the pervasiveness of these devices, there is a growing need to train people on how to keep them secure.
